			<description><![CDATA[<p>No idea if it&#039;s even possible to do what you&#039;re asking for but I may present an alternative.</p><p>Not sure where it comes from but I have always been able to move around windows by holding down alt while clicking and holding left mouse button, and it doesn&#039;t appear to matter where on the window you click and hold. And one can use alt+right mouse button for resizing windows.</p>]]></description>
